What is the difference between Internship Infor Syteline Developer vs Infor Syteline Developer?

AspectInternship Infor Syteline DeveloperInfor Syteline Developer
Experience LevelEntry-level, internship positionMid-level to senior professional
CertificationsTypically no certifications requiredRelevant certifications may be preferred
Work EnvironmentTraining, mentorship, learning-focusedProject execution, client interaction
ResponsibilitiesAssist with basic Syteline tasks, learn system functionalitiesDevelop, customize, and maintain Syteline ERP modules

In summary, an Internship Infor Syteline Developer is an entry-level role focused on learning and supporting Syteline systems, while an Infor Syteline Developer is a more experienced professional responsible for developing and maintaining ERP solutions. The internship provides foundational exposure, whereas the developer role involves active project contributions.

ROLE - Senior Infor CloudSuite Industrial (SyteLine) Developer
We are seeking a highly skilled Senior Infor CloudSuite Industrial (SyteLine) Developer to join our growing team. This role offers the opportunity to work on impactful ERP initiatives, designing and customizing solutions that drive operational efficiency and business success. You'll be part of a collaborative environment where innovation and technical excellence are valued. The ideal candidate is a self-starter with deep expertise in Infor CSI (SyteLine), Microsoft .NET technologies, and SQL, and is comfortable working independently or as part of a team.

KNOWLEDGE & SKILLS REQUIRED:
  • 10+ years of experience in software or systems development, with a strong foundation in enterprise applications.
  • 5+ years of hands-on development experience with Infor CloudSuite Industrial (SyteLine), including customizations, integrations, and enhancements (V9/V10).
  • Solid understanding of manufacturing and sales business processes, with the ability to align technical solutions to business objectives.
  • Advanced proficiency in Microsoft .NET technologies, including T-SQL, C#, and VB.NET.
  • Expert-level skills in SQL, including stored procedure development, database design, and performance optimization.
  • Experience creating business reports using SQL, SSRS, and Crystal Reports.
  • Familiarity with Infor OS ecosystem, including IDM, Doc-Trak, Workflows a strong plus.
